mail merge find contact folder
I am trying to create a mail merge and word cannot find the folder for my
contact list in outlook. It gives an error "the path specified for the file g:\outlook\saved emails.pst is not valid" How do I find where the contact folder is stored? |

mail merge find contact folder
As far as I know you cannot specify a .pst directly as the source of
your mail merge recipients - you would usually do one of the following: a. start in Outlook, choose some contacts, then go to Tools-Mail Merge ... b. use the facilities provided in the Mail Merge Wizard (or, in Word 2007, in the Select Recipients dropdown in the Mailings tab). Typically, (a) is a better approach, but you may have problems if you have different versions of Outlook and Word; (b) can be problematic as it goes through an even more complicated path to get the data. If the reason you are trying to select a .pst directly is because it isn't the .pst you actually have set up to use with Outlook, it would probably be simpler to attach the .pst as an extra file in Outlook, and use approach (a).
